Introduction to Contract Governance Frameworks

Contract governance frameworks are the backbone of contract management within organizations. They encompass the policies, procedures, roles, and responsibilities established to ensure that contracts are created, executed, and managed in a consistent, compliant, and efficient manner. By defining clear guidelines and standards for contract management, governance frameworks help organizations minimize risks, ensure compliance, and maximize the value of their contractual relationships.

Key Components of Effective Contract Governance Frameworks

  • Governance Structure: A robust governance structure defines the organizational hierarchy, roles, and responsibilities related to contract management. It identifies key stakeholders, such as contract owners, approvers, and administrators, and outlines their respective duties and authority levels.
  • Policies and Procedures: Effective governance frameworks include comprehensive policies and procedures governing all aspects of contract management, from contract creation and execution to monitoring and compliance. These policies establish clear guidelines for contract negotiations, approvals, renewals, and terminations, ensuring consistency and compliance with organizational standards and regulatory requirements.
  • Risk Management Processes: Risk management is a critical component of contract governance frameworks. Organizations must identify, assess, and mitigate risks associated with contracts to protect their interests and minimize exposure to potential liabilities. Risk management processes should include risk identification, assessment, mitigation, and monitoring strategies tailored to the organization’s specific needs and objectives.
  • Contract Lifecycle Management: Contract lifecycle management (CLM) encompasses the processes and technologies used to manage contracts from initiation to expiration. Effective governance frameworks incorporate CLM best practices, including centralized contract repositories, automated workflows, document version control, and audit trails, to streamline contract management processes and enhance visibility and control over contract lifecycles.
  • Compliance Monitoring and Reporting: Contract governance frameworks should include mechanisms for monitoring contract compliance and reporting on key performance indicators (KPIs) and metrics. Compliance monitoring involves tracking contract obligations, deadlines, and milestones to ensure adherence to contractual terms and regulatory requirements. Reporting capabilities enable organizations to assess contract performance, identify trends, and make informed decisions to optimize contract management processes and outcomes.
  • Training and Education: To ensure the successful implementation of contract governance frameworks, organizations must invest in training and education programs for employees involved in contract management. Training initiatives should cover contract governance policies, procedures, and best practices, as well as relevant legal and regulatory requirements, to empower staff with the knowledge and skills needed to effectively manage contracts and mitigate risks.
  • Continuous Improvement: Continuous improvement is essential for maintaining the effectiveness and relevance of contract governance frameworks over time. Organizations should regularly review and evaluate their governance processes, identify areas for improvement, and implement corrective actions and enhancements to address evolving business needs, regulatory changes, and industry trends.

Benefits of Effective Contract Governance Frameworks

Implementing effective contract governance frameworks offers numerous benefits for organizations, including:

  • Risk Mitigation: By establishing clear policies, procedures, and controls, organizations can identify and mitigate risks associated with contracts, reducing the likelihood of disputes, financial losses, and legal liabilities.
  • Compliance Assurance: Effective governance frameworks ensure compliance with legal, regulatory, and contractual requirements, minimizing the risk of non-compliance and associated penalties or legal consequences.
  • Cost Savings: Streamlining contract management processes and optimizing contract terms can lead to significant cost savings for organizations by improving efficiency, reducing legal fees, and enhancing vendor management practices.
  • Enhanced Performance: Contract governance frameworks enable organizations to monitor contract performance effectively, driving performance improvements, and maximizing the value of contractual relationships.
  • Transparency and Accountability: By promoting transparency and accountability in contract management processes, governance frameworks foster trust and confidence among stakeholders, enhancing collaboration and communication throughout the contract lifecycle.
